Co to jest funkcja Get_template_part w WordPress?
Opublikowany: 2022-11-10W WordPressie funkcja get_template_part służy do ładowania części szablonu do szablonu. Ta funkcja znajduje się w głównym pliku WordPress wp-includes/template.php. Części szablonu są przechowywane w katalogu /wp-content/themes/your-theme/. Mogą znajdować się w dowolnym podkatalogu, ale muszą mieć rozszerzenie .php. Funkcja get_template_part ma dwa parametry: Pierwszym parametrem jest slug, czyli nazwa pliku części szablonu bez rozszerzenia .php. Drugim parametrem jest nazwa zmiennej, która zostanie użyta do załadowania części szablonu. Ta zmienna jest opcjonalna i jeśli zostanie pominięta, WordPress użyje ślimaka jako nazwy zmiennej. Oto przykład użycia funkcji get_template_part w szablonie: get_template_part( 'content', 'single' ); ? > W tym przykładzie plik części szablonu o nazwie content-single.php zostanie załadowany do szablonu. Zmienna, która zostanie użyta do załadowania części szablonu to $content_single.
Dzięki funkcji get_template_part() możesz scentralizować dowolny blok kodu, który prawdopodobnie będzie się powtarzał w częściach, zmniejszając duplikację i czyniąc pliki szablonów bardziej czytelnymi. Celem tego artykułu jest wyjaśnienie, jak działa funkcja, a także wyjaśnienie, dlaczego jest ona ważna w motywach WordPress i jak jej używać we własnym rozwoju motywów. Oprócz drugiego parametru funkcja ma jeszcze silniejszą funkcjonalność dzięki funkcji get_template_part() w funkcji get_template_part(). Ta funkcja umożliwia określenie części szablonu, która działa dla stron, a następnie zwrócenie jej do lokalizacji index.php w hierarchii szablonów. Ta metoda jest często używana do tworzenia pomocnych, opisowych szablonów, jak widać w Dwudziestu piętnastu. Metoda get_template_part() WordPressa jest potężną i wartościową częścią backendu WordPressa. Jeśli chodzi o motywy potomne, nie ma potrzeby dołączania wymagania pliku części szablonu. Ponieważ include() i require() nie są specyficzne dla WordPressa, motyw potomny musi zastąpić wszystkie pliki używające tych elementów szablonu .
Czym są części szablonu?

Część szablonu to modułowy szablon, którego można użyć do zbudowania większego szablonu. Części szablonu to zwykle małe, samodzielne fragmenty kodu, które można ponownie wykorzystać w różnych kontekstach. Na przykład częścią szablonu może być nagłówek, stopka lub pasek boczny.
Szablon bloku składa się z listy bloków w swojej najbardziej podstawowej formie. W szablonie można umieścić dowolny blok WordPress. Aby zamknąć blok, musi być umieszczony w tym samym szablonie, co jego otwierający znacznik. Aby dodać atrybuty stylu do bloków, musisz umieścić je w znaczniku HTML:. Konieczne jest połączenie tych słów. Sekcja Szablony Edytora Witryny wyświetla duży wybór szablonów, które można łatwo edytować. W ramach swojego motywu utwórz nowy plik HTML dla każdego szablonu i umieść go w folderze szablonów.
Każda część szablonu to niestandardowy typ posta w WordPress znany jako WP_template_part. W edytorze możesz wyrównywać szablony, gdy służą jako wewnętrzne bloki. Przycisk Dodaj nowy umożliwia tworzenie nieograniczonej liczby części szablonu. Na koniec możesz usunąć części szablonu utworzone przez użytkownika, które zostały dostosowane w szablonach motywów. Pierwszym krokiem jest wprowadzenie nazwy części szablonu, a następnie zostaniesz poproszony o wybranie jednej z trzech sekcji: ogólnej, nagłówka i stopki. Zmiany w Edytorze Witryny są przechowywane w bazie danych i nie są odzwierciedlane w plikach HTML motywu.
Szablony funkcji, takie jak makra, nazwy funkcji jako argumenty i zwracają obiekt szablonu. Zmienne te służą do definiowania bloków kodu wielokrotnego użytku. Szablon klasy, podobnie jak funkcje szablonu, służy do definiowania klas, ale nie działa jako funkcja. Mogą być używane do definiowania struktury i zachowania klas, oprócz definiowania ich struktury. W przeciwieństwie do szablonów klas, szablony zmiennych służą do definiowania zmiennych. Zmienne można zdefiniować jako funkcję, definiując ich strukturę i zachowanie. Możliwe jest kontrolowanie układu i stylu strony internetowej za pomocą szablonu. Aby kontrolować układ i styl strony internetowej, można użyć szablonu.

Czym są szablony nazwać dwie różne części szablonu?
Plik HTML jest składnikiem szablonu, po którym następuje typ postu (WP_template_part) i blok. Dlaczego brzmi to tak skomplikowanie? Możesz przeglądać zawartość, którą umieściłeś w nich, po prostu używając ich jako bloków. Szablon nie musi być używany, ale autorzy motywów mogą używać mniejszych części wielokrotnego użytku do tworzenia motywu.
Trzy rodzaje szablonów
Jest to system trójwarstwowy: br>,br>, andbr>. Literał szablonu: literał szablonu to ciąg tekstu używany do tworzenia funkcji lub klasy ogólnej. Metodą wejściową jest funkcja szablonu , która jako dane wejściowe przyjmuje ogólną klasę lub funkcję. Istnieją trzy typy szablonów: szablony klas, szablony funkcji i szablony ogólne.
Jakie są tagi szablonu?
Szablony używają tagów szablonów do dynamicznego wyświetlania informacji lub dostosowywania bloga w inny sposób, dzięki czemu może być zindywidualizowany i interesujący dla Ciebie.
Jak korzystać z plików szablonów i tagów w WordPress
Co to jest plik szablonu? Definicje są częścią pliku szablonu, który jest plikiem tekstowym. Jest to zestaw dyrektyw, które instruują motyw silnika WordPress, jak wygenerować określone dane wyjściowe. Pojedyncza linia, taka jak *br*, definiuje szablon jako przykład. .htaccess Używając tej linii, szablon znany jako default.php może być użyty, gdy nie ma odniesienia do żadnego konkretnego szablonu. Co to są tagi szablonów? Znacznik szablonu to funkcja PHP, która dynamicznie generuje i wyświetla dane. Można ich używać do pobierania danych z bazy danych, generowania kodu HTML lub obsługi wielu innych zadań. Aby użyć tagu szablonu, musisz dołączyć bibliotekę WordPress Theme Engine do pliku PHP i dołączyć nazwę funkcji jako ciąg znaków poprzedzony prefiksem thetemplate_. Na przykład znacznik szablonu post_list zostałby użyty do wygenerowania listy postów z bazy danych. phpbr to ciąg słów Ten szablon zawiera listę postów. > Strona wyświetli listę postów z bazy danych, które zostaną wygenerowane tą metodą.
Jak używać części w WordPressie?

Aby używać podszablonów w WordPressie, musisz najpierw utworzyć plik o nazwie header.php. Ten plik powinien zawierać kod nagłówka Twojej witryny. Następnie musisz utworzyć plik o nazwie footer.php. Ten plik powinien zawierać kod stopki Twojej witryny. Na koniec musisz dołączyć te pliki do plików szablonów WordPress .
Modularyzuj swój kod WordPress
Tworząc kod WordPress, użyj podszablonów, aby go ustandaryzować i zmodularyzować. Przenosząc wspólny kod do częściowych plików, możesz utrzymać swój motyw i wtyczki uporządkowane i łatwiejsze w utrzymaniu. Co więcej, grupując powiązane pliki, możesz stworzyć prostą w użyciu strukturę modularności dla treści WordPress.